About Ecuador
Ecuador, a nation of remarkable biodiversity, captivates with its Andean peaks, Amazonian rainforests, and the unique Galapagos Islands, offering a rich tapestry of cultural heritage and natural wonders. While press freedom has improved in recent years, journalists continue to navigate a complex landscape, facing threats particularly when reporting on organized crime and narcotrafficking, which shapes the dynamics of news coverage.

Media landscape
Ecuador's media environment is diverse, with a mix of private and public outlets, though independent media often faces funding challenges. Despite recent reforms aimed at a less restrictive online environment, journalists still contend with significant threats, especially those covering organized crime and corruption.
